Revision [4065]
This is an old revision of DarTar made by DarTar on 2005-01-06 08:30:34.
DarTar
Wikka is structure. To shape its surface you can create and select TestSkin skins
Some hot selections:
- UserAdmin - proposal for a user management interface
- IncludeRemote - proposal of a plugin for fetching wikka-formatted content from the main Wikka server
- WikkaMenus - proposal of a module for customizing wikka menus
- TestSkin - beta skin selector;
- WikkaSkinEditor - proposal of an action for selecting and editing CSS stylesheets
- DescribeActions - proposal of an action for describing available actions
I've created and maintain openformats.org a site for promoting open formats based on Wikka 1.1.3, with a couple of hacks:
- UTF-8 Support - thanks to AndreaRossato's HandlingUTF8 code and unvaluable help;
- UserAdmin - user management interface;
- FeedbackAction - displays a module to send feedback to the wiki administrator;
- IncludeAction (adapted from Wikini) - includes more pages in a single page;
- NotifyOnChange - a simple way to get an email notification each time a page is edited (adapted from Wikini);
- dynamic CSS - random modifications of the wiki layout;
- altlang links for same page in different languages;
- HideReferrers - avoids spambot problems by hiding the referrer link to anonymous users;
- LoggedUsersHomepage - creates a different homepage for logged users;
- RedirectOnLogin - automatically redirects to a specific page on login/logout;
- SmartTitle - checks if a ==Header== of any level is included in the page body, otherwise displays pagename;
I'm also using a slightly modified version of Wikka 1.1.3 on webepistemology.org.
My Wikka Wishlist
Here's some ideas and dreams about the future of WikkaWakka:
Main development
- Full UTF-8 Support
Allowing users with different charsets to edit/display wiki pages looks like one of the top priorities. AndreaRossato has given some nice HandlingUTF8 suggestions on how to do this. A working wikka version with full UTF-8 support can be seen here
- Extensive documentation
I think that providing a solid documentation about the main features of a wikka engine, as well as a howto for the main actions included in the default distribution, is a top priority issue. A well-documented wiki is likely to have a better visibility and to encourage the unexperienced user to try it and perhaps install it.
- CSS optimization
I would like to see all the stylistic tags in the code (especially, table or layer styles within specific actions) completely replaced by the appropriate CSS classes
- Localization
Per avvicinare utenti di lingue diverse al mondo dei wiki: see WikkaInternationalization
- Group support in ACL
Already under construction: see HelpWanted
- Email Notification
Here's how I hacked it: NotifyOnChange
Minor Fixes
- TextSearchExpanded
Should TextSearchExpanded search the source or the public content of the page? I think the user is mainly interested in the page content, not in the code (unless the search field is supposed to work as a tool for developers/website maintainers). All formatting and actions should, hence, be masked from the search results and stripped out from the displayed context.
- Login page
Some unexperienced users of a wikka-run site reported difficulties in understanding the registration procedure. Perhaps the registration/login page might be improved, by:
- adding to the default installation a page about WikiName (the current link in usersettings leads to a nonexistent page)
- instead of using twice "login/register" on the buttons, use "login" for the first and "register" for the second.
- WikiEDIT
I would like to be able to toggle the WikiEDIT interface on or off from the config file.
Admin Tools
- Administration page
Might come with the default install. Readable by admins only, it contains links to all admin/management tools
- Enhancement of Wikka-accessible configuration options
It would be nice to improve the management of some options directly from the wiki:
- Wikka management of the template (especially the top navigation menu) -- Already possible on WackoWiki
- Wikka management of robots.txt -- Have a page for reading, editing and writing robots.txt
- Wikka management of CSS, themes -- Already possible on CitiWiki
- Power Admin Tools
Add capability to remove users, send user feedback, manage groups etc., perhaps as an admin-only extension of the lastusers action. See UserAdmin
- Site Stats
Documentation Needed
NilsLindenberg is doing a great job in writing a WikkaDocumentation basic documentation.
Backlinks
AdminBadWords
AdminDevelopmentDiscussions
AdminFreeMindTests
AdminIRC
AdminReleaseCheckList
AdminReleaseCheckList1163
AdminReleaseCheckList1164
AdminReleaseCheckList1165
AdminReleaseCheckList1166
AdminReleaseCheckList1167
AdminReleaseCheckList117
AdminReleaseCheckList12
AdminReleaseCheckList131
AdminReleaseCheckList137
AdminReleaseCheckList14
AdminReleaseCheckList142
AdminReleaseCheckListTemplate
AdminSpamLog
AdminWatchList
AdminWikkaWebsite
AdrianB
AdvancedReferrersHandler
ANewHomeForWikka
AutomaticUserPageCreation
CategorySystemOverhaul
CloneAction
CloneHandler
CreditsPage
CyClope
DaC
DanWestUserReg
DarTar2
DartarI18N
DarTarLinks
DateAndTimeFormat
DescribeActions
DocumentationLanguageLinking
ExperimentalFeatures
FeedbackAction
FeedbackActionUpgrade
FileManagerHack
GmBowen
GoogleMap
GregorLindner
GSoC2008App
HandlingReferrers
HideReferrers
HierarchiesAndInheritance
HighlighterAction
HTMLHandler
ImprovedRecentChanges
IncludeRemote
InlineCommentFormatter
InvisibleWiki
KynnJones
LinkRewriting
LoggedUsersHomepage
MagicWords
MeetingNotes20100131
Mod040fSmartPageTitles
Mod043fCloneHandler
NewAdminChecklist
OneYearOld
OpenSearchForWikka
PageAdminAction
PageAdminPrune
ProgrammingHelp
RegexLibrary
RegexpindexActionInfo
RegisterAction
RemovingUsers
RyeBread
ServerProblems
Signature
SmartTitle
SuggestionBox
SuggestionsArchive
TestSkin
ThoughtsOnSecurity
TomSpilman
UpgradeNotes
UserAdmin
UserGroupWikkaCrew
UserMap
UserMenus
UserSettingsPanel
UTF8DatabaseCollation
ValidPageNames
VirtualWikiFarm
WantedFormatters
WikiInAVacuum
WikipediaAction
WikiTemplate
Wikka1164Development
WikkaAccessibility
WikkaAndBrowsers
WikkaAndEmail
WikkaBugs
WikkaBugsResolved
WikkaCodeStructure
WikkaCSS
WikkaDevelopment
WikkaDevelopmentFR
WikkaExtensibleMarkup
WikkaFAQ
WikkaFilters
WikkaFolksonomy
WikkaInternationalization
WikkaMenulets
WikkaMenus
WikkaMenusAdmin
WikkaReleaseNotes
WikkaReleaseNotesDiscussion
WikkaSkinEditor
WikkaSkins
WikkaSkinSelector
WikkaSkinsRepository
WikkaSpamFighting
WikkaTables
WikkaToPDF
WishListFor117
CategoryUsers